这个查询的错误是,如果我将$1,$2,$3,$4,$5替换为它工作的实际值,
这是我的代码。
let queryText = "INSERT INTO`calculator_challenge`.`calculations`
(`number1`, `operator`, `number2`, `total`, `created_at`)
VALUES ($1, $2, $3, $4, $5);";
pool.query(queryText, [calc_obj.number1, calc_obj.operator, calc_obj.number2, calc_obj.total, calc_obj.created_at], (error, result, fields) => {
if (error) throw error;
res.send(JSON.stringify(result));
});
});发布于 2020-05-17 06:21:28
更新代码如下:(我包含了一些引号)
let queryText = "INSERT INTO`calculator_challenge`.`calculations`(`number1`, `operator`, `number2`, `total`, `created_at`) VALUES ('$1', '$2', '$3', '$4', '$5')";https://stackoverflow.com/questions/61842954
复制相似问题